如何破解excel工作表保护(破解xls工作表保护)
发布时间:2026-03-28 19:41:34 作者:阿甘好奇
破解Excel工作表保护的实用技巧
在日常工作或学习中,我们经常会遇到需要破解Excel工作表保护的情况。保护工作表可以防止他人修改或删除数据,但有时候我们确实需要访问这些被保护的数据。下面,我将分享一些破解Excel工作表保护的实用技巧,帮助你轻松解锁。
1. 密码破解工具
- Passware:一款功能强大的密码破解软件,支持多种文件格式的密码破解。
- Advanced Office Password Recovery:专门针对Microsoft Office文档的密码破解工具。
需要注意的是,使用这些工具破解密码可能涉及法律风险,请确保你的行为合法合规。
2. 修改注册表
另一种方法是修改Windows注册表。以下步骤可以帮助你完成:
1. 打开注册表编辑器(regedit.exe)。
2. 导航到HKEY_CURRENT_USER\Software\Microsoft\Office\版本号\Excel\Security。
3. 在右侧窗格中找到“ProtectStructure”和“ProtectContents”键。
4. 将这两个键的值从1更改为0。
请注意,修改注册表可能对系统稳定性造成影响,操作前请确保备份注册表。
3. 使用VBA代码
```vba
Sub RemoveSheetProtection()
Dim ws As Worksheet
For Each ws In ThisWorkbook.Sheets
ws.Unprotect Password:=""
Next ws
End Sub
```
将这段代码复制到Excel的VBA编辑器中,并运行它,即可移除所有工作表的保护。
4. 替换文件
最后一种方法是替换被保护的Excel文件。以下步骤可以帮助你完成:
1. 找到被保护的Excel文件,将其复制到另一个文件夹。
2. 打开该文件夹,将文件名中的扩展名从.xlsx更改为.zip。
3. 解压.zip文件,找到名为xl目录。
4. 在xl目录中找到名为worksheets目录。
5. 打开worksheets目录,找到被保护的文件。
6. 使用文本编辑器打开该文件,删除所有密码相关的行。
7. 保存文件,将其重命名为.xlsx。
8. 将该文件复制回原来的文件夹,替换原文件。
这种方法比较复杂,但可以确保彻底移除工作表保护。
相关问题
问:破解Excel工作表保护是否违法?
答:破解Excel工作表保护本身并不违法,但使用破解工具或方法进行非法行为可能触犯法律。
问:破解Excel工作表保护有哪些风险?
答:使用密码破解工具可能涉及法律风险,修改注册表可能影响系统稳定性,使用VBA代码可能需要一定的编程知识,替换文件可能丢失一些格式。
问:如何避免工作表被他人破解保护?
答:设置强密码,定期更新密码,限制对文件的访问权限,使用加密功能等。
本文标签: 两仪 电摇嘲讽是什么意思 曾轶可私奔吉他谱 优酷会员账号可以几个人同时用 用友nc客户端